Responsibilities

You will ensure that the nursing care plan is being followed by being a Champion of the Select Medical Way, which includes putting the patient first, helping to improve quality of life for the community in which you live and work, continuing to develop and explore new ideas, providing high-quality care and doing well by doing what is right.

  • Receiving admissions and/or transfers to the unit.
  • Initial and ongoing systematic patient assessment.
  • Timely and accurate documentation using appropriate systems.
  • Interpreting assessment/diagnostic data including labs and telemetry.
  • Ensuring medical orders are transcribed and processed accurately.
  • Competence in Rapid Response and code events.
  • Promoting continuous quality improvement.
  • Instructing and counseling patients/families.

About
Select Medical is one of the largest operators of critical illness recovery hospitals (previously referred to as long term acute care hospitals), rehabilitation hospitals (previously referred to as inpatient rehabilitation facilities), outpatient rehabilitation clinics, and occupational health centers in the United States based on the number of facilities. As of June 30, 2019, Select Medical had operations in 47 states and the District of Columbia. Select Medical operated 100 critical illness recovery hospitals in 28 states, 28 rehabilitation hospitals in 12 states, and 1,695 outpatient rehabilitation clinics in 37 states and the District of Columbia. Concentra, a joint venture subsidiary, operated 526 occupational health centers in 41 states as of June 30, 2019. Concentra also provides contract services at employer worksites and Department of Veterans Affairs community-based outpatient clinics.
